The Storage Squeeze: When Solar Overproduces

California's 2023 grid emergency taught us a harsh lesson—during last September's heatwave, the state curtailed 2.4 GWh of solar power daily while struggling with evening energy deficits. Three core challenges emerge:

  • Day-night production mismatch (up to 80% output variance)
  • Regional grid limitations (average 23% transmission loss)
  • Weather dependency (output drops 65% during storms)

Battery Chemistry Breakthroughs

Alpex Solar's engineers have sort of cracked the code with modular lithium-iron-phosphate (LiFePO4) systems. Unlike traditional lead-acid setups, these batteries:

  1. Offer 6,000+ charge cycles (triple conventional lifespan)
  2. Operate at 98% round-trip efficiency
  3. Maintain stable performance from -4°F to 131°F

Future-Proofing Your Energy Independence

With the 30% federal tax credit extension through 2035, solar-plus-storage payback periods have shrunk to 4-7 years in most states. But wait, no—it's not just about economics. The real value lies in:

  • Grid resilience during extreme weather events
  • Carbon footprint reduction (8.2 tons CO2/year per household)
  • Energy sovereignty for off-grid communities

Pro Tip: Load-Shifting 101

Program your system to charge batteries during 9 AM-3 PM peak sun hours, then discharge from 6-10 PM when utility rates spike. This simple timing tweak can boost savings by 37% annually.
